Ordinals
alpha
Sat 907459022888930
decimal
181491.4022888930
degree
0°181491′51″4022888930‴
percentile
43.212334470815975%
name
hkpqfcmllwx
cycle
0
epoch
0
period
90
block
181491
offset
4022888930
rarity
common
timestamp
2012-05-25 04:43:04 UTC
prev
next